How many milligrams of caffeine are in coffee ice cream?

Half-cup servings of Häagen-coffee Dazs’s ice cream have 29 milligrams of caffeine, Edy’s coffee ice cream has 15 milligrams of caffeine, and Dreyer’s coffee ice cream contains 11 milligrams of caffeine, according to the company.

How much caffeine is too much?

Caffeine should not be consumed in excess of 400 milligrams (mg) per day by otherwise healthy persons. That’s the equivalent of four 8-ounce cups of brewed coffee or ten 12-ounce cans of Coca-Cola. It is recommended that teenagers restrict their caffeine intake to less than 100 mg per day (one 8-ounce cup of coffee or about two cans of cola).

What naturally has caffeine?

Caffeine is an alkaloid that occurs naturally in over 60 plant species, the most well-known of which are cocoa beans, kola nuts, tea leaves, and coffee beans. Caffeine is found in small amounts in other foods such as tea leaves and coffee beans. Yerba maté, guarana berries, guayusa, and the yaupon holly are some of the other natural sources of caffeine available.
